Автоматическое обновление ComboBox с привязкой к данным C #
-
03-07-2019 - |
Вопрос
У меня есть комбинированный список, связанный с таблицей базы данных. Когда пользователь вставляет новый фрагмент данных в таблицу, я хочу, чтобы комбинированный список автоматически обновлялся для отображения этих данных, однако я не уверен в том, как мне поступить.
Помощь будет принята с благодарностью.
Решение
У меня есть нечто похожее на это в моей программе.
Каждый раз, когда обновляется мое представление данных, я очищаю комбинированный список и пополняю его.
Что-то вроде (мой код сейчас недоступен, но это общая идея):
if (!combobox.isempty())
{
combobox.clear()
}
// Fill combobox here
Другие советы
Я думаю, что в тот момент, когда вы знаете, что добавляете некоторые данные в эту таблицу, вам следует позвонить:
yourcombobox.Databind();
также вы должны снова определить свойство yourcombobox.DataSource
перед вызовом Databind ()